3) Let the width = x meter

Length = (x + 12) meter

The perimeter of the rectangular field is 104

2(x + x + 12) = 104

or, 2(2x + 12) = 104

or, 2x + 12 = 52

or, 2x = 40

or, x = 20

So the width is 20 meter

And the length = 20 + 12 = 32 meter
